To allow the Police Athletic League, the Community Services Unit, the Crime Analysis Unit, and FOD Administrative Office to deviate from the department dress code due to the requirements of their jobs.
The Police Athletic League and the Community Services Unit will be allowed to wear uniforms as outlined in this directive.
3.1 All supervisors will ensure that all employees comply with the requirements of this directive.
3.2 Employees will adhere to the requirements of this directive and only wear uniforms approved by this directive.
4.1 Police Athletic League
1. The following clothing may be worn by employees assigned to the Police Athletic League:
a. Blue or White Tee Shirt or Polo Type Shirt (long or short sleeve) with the PAL logo on the left breast
b. Khaki Pants or Shorts
c. Black or White Athletic Shoes
d. Navy Blue sweat shirt and pants with the PAL logo on the left breast and left pant leg
4.2 Community Services Section
1. The following uniform may be worn by Crime Prevention Inspectors for special details (fingerprinting, community assessments, surveys, etc.):
a. Black polo shirt, long or short sleeve, with the APD emblem on left breast
b. Khaki Pants
4.3 Crime Analysis Unit
1. The following uniform may be worn by employees assigned to the Crime Analysis Unit:
a. Black Polo Shirt, long or short sleeve, with the APD emblem on left breast
b. Khaki Pants
4.4 FOD Administrative Office
1. The following uniform may be worn by employees assigned to the FOD Administrative Office:
a. Black Polo Shirt, long or short sleeve, with the APD emblem on left breast
b. Khaki Pants
